The Story:

Reinhard Werner, an old man, returned from his walk at dusk and entered his home. He climbed the stairs and sat in his usual place in his study. His housekeeper had not yet turned on the lights for the evening. As it became darker, a ray of moonlight entered the room and fell on a woman’s portrait. Whispering the name “Elisabeth!” Reinhard recollected his youth.
